Description

Mediation essentially involves the movement from God to man and man to God as it specifically relates to the person of Christ. The launching point for this series is found in 1 Timothy 2:5. Lectures include:

  • Revelation and Reconciliation
  • The Person of the Mediator
  • Christ's Mediation / Human Response

Thomas F. Torrance is Professor Emeritus of Christian Dogmatics, University of Edinburgh. He is author of Space, Time and Resurrection, The Christian Frame of Mind, The Mediation of Christ and numerous other books.
